Eight Values Of Free Expression (Blog Post #4)

 





 Free expression is one of the fundamental values that underpin democratic societies. It ensures that individuals can express their opinions without fear of censorship or persecution. In addition to being a fundamental right, free expression is critical to promoting a healthy, diverse, and vibrant society. There are several values associated with free expression that we have gone over in class, including the marketplace of ideas, participation in self-government, stable change, individual self-fulfillment, check on governmental power, promote tolerance, promote innovation, and lastly protect dissent.

The marketplace of ideas is a critical component of a healthy intellectual environment. In a democratic society, everyone should be free to express their ideas and opinions without fear of censorship or persecution. The marketplace of ideas ensures that the best ideas are able to rise to the top, and that new and innovative ideas are given a chance to be heard. By encouraging the free exchange of ideas, the marketplace of ideas helps to promote diversity, innovation, and creativity. Participation in self-government is another critical value associated with free expression. In a democratic society, citizens have the right and responsibility to participate in the decision-making process. In order to do so effectively, citizens must be informed and knowledgeable about public issues. Free expression helps to ensure that citizens have access to a wide range of information and opinions, allowing them to make informed decisions and participate effectively in the democratic process.

Free expression also promotes stable change and individual self-fulfillment. The ability to express oneself freely is a necessary component of personal growth and self-fulfillment. Additionally, free expression allows for the peaceful exchange of ideas, which can help to promote stable change within society. By providing a space for individuals to express their views, free expression helps to ensure that new ideas and perspectives are given a fair hearing.

Perhaps one of the most important values associated with free expression is the check on governmental power. In a democratic society, it is essential to have a free and independent media that can hold governments accountable for their actions. The media plays a critical role in ensuring that governments are transparent and honest, and that citizens are informed about public issues. Without a free media, governments can become corrupt and authoritarian, and citizens may be left powerless to challenge their actions.

Promoting tolerance is another critical value associated with free expression that has been discussed in our class. In order for a diverse society to function effectively, it is essential that individuals are tolerant of one another's views and beliefs. Free expression helps to promote tolerance by allowing individuals to express their views and beliefs openly and honestly, without fear of persecution. By encouraging the free exchange of ideas, free expression helps to break down barriers between individuals and promote greater understanding and empathy.

Finally, free expression promotes innovation. By encouraging the free exchange of ideas, free expression helps to create an environment that is conducive to innovation and creativity. When individuals are free to express their ideas and opinions openly and honestly, new and innovative ideas can emerge, leading to greater progress and advancement.
